Company Description
We are SGS – the world's leading testing, inspection and certification company. We are recognized as the global benchmark for sustainability, quality and integrity. Our 99,600 employees operate a network of 2,600 offices and laboratories, working together to enable a better, safer and more interconnected world. Our brand promise – when you need to be sure – underscores our commitment to trust, integrity and reliability.
SGS’s Life Sciences services support the pharmaceutical, biotech, and healthcare sectors with expert testing, clinical research, auditing, and certification—ensuring product safety, quality, and regulatory compliance from development to market.
